I've done it a couple times (last time was 2006, i think). Its a nice, smallish race. No big frills or anything. The swim isn't bad. I had trouble with the current the last time, but its nothing too hard. The bike has some rolling hills, but isn't impossible. The run is mind-numbingly flat, and not very shaded. But there are retired folks out and and about in golf carts cheering you on. Afterwards they serve Little Caesars pizza in a church hall.

I've always had a fun time at this race..i'm planning on doing it this year if i can fit it in between family obligations.

It's a shame they have not promoted this event more.  I live 20' away, and I've done it once.   Like megger said, it's a fairly easy course.  The bike is an out and back with the back being more downhill, which I like.  It's also a shorter course; the swim has been way short, the run is only 6 mi (flat, mostly unshaded and hot).  There was one ol timer with a misting fan on the course, which was nice.  There can be issues with algae blooms and sometimes sea nettles from what I understand, but they will du it up if it is unsafe.  AND there was beer at the end, big plus!  I should be able to do it this year if they get their act together.

I did this one last year. Good race. Relatively inexpensive and a very fast course. Bike is gently rolling and very fast. Hot run, but it is only 6 miles. I would recommend the race if it fits your schedule and goals.
